gson 如何跳过json的顶键?

9nvpjoqh  于 2022-11-06  发布在  其他
关注(0)|答案(2)|浏览(143)

存在从Retrofit接口获取的具有根关键字playlist的JSON。Gson库无法将其解析为数据类。是否有方法在创建模型之前执行“单步执行”播放列表关键字?
第一个

cxfofazt

cxfofazt1#

你可以使用这个网站json to Kotlin,它对于长json数据非常有用。对于你的情况,你有两个对象,主对象和播放列表对象,所以你需要两个数据类:

data class PlaylistResponse (
    val playlist: Playlist
)

data class Playlist (
    val name: String,
    val description: String
)
bksxznpy

bksxznpy2#

试试这个

data class PlaylistObject(
    val playlist: Playlist
)

data class Playlist(
     val description: String,
      val name: String
)

相关问题